Cost of Living: Bend, OR vs Oregon City, OR

Quick rent-and-take-home comparison

Using a baseline of $70,000/yr gross, take-home is about $4,006/mo in Bend, OR versus $4,006/mo in Oregon City, OR. In the model, rent is about 25.75% of gross in Bend, OR versus 23.4% in Oregon City, OR, so Oregon City, OR tends to feel more affordable for rent.

Cost of Living Index

Bend, OR: 100 (U.S. = 100) · Oregon City, OR: 100 (U.S. = 100)

Both cities have the same cost-of-living index (U.S. average = 100).

Median Rent

Bend, OR: $1,679/mo (midpoint of 1BR/2BR) · Oregon City, OR: $1,526/mo

Median rent in Bend, OR is $153/mo higher than in Oregon City, OR.

Median Home Price

Bend, OR: $646,800 · Oregon City, OR: $531,400

Median home price in Bend, OR is $115,400 higher than in Oregon City, OR.

Median Household Income

Bend, OR: $88,792 · Oregon City, OR: $94,648

Oregon City, OR has a higher median household income than Bend, OR by $5,856.
